CVE-2024-32921
📋 TL;DR
This vulnerability allows local privilege escalation on affected Android devices through an out-of-bounds write in the lwis_fence.c component. Attackers can exploit this without user interaction or additional privileges. Only Pixel devices running specific Android versions are affected.

🎯 Exploit Status
Exploitation requires local access but no user interaction. The vulnerability is in a kernel-level component, making exploitation non-trivial but feasible for skilled attackers.
🛠️ Fix & Mitigation
✅ Official Fix
Patch Version: June 2024 Android security patch or later
Vendor Advisory: https://source.android.com/security/bulletin/pixel/2024-06-01
Restart Required: Yes
Instructions:
1. Check for system updates in Settings > System > System update. 2. Download and install the June 2024 security patch. 3. Restart the device when prompted. 4. Verify the patch is applied by checking the build number.

🔍 How to Verify
Check if Vulnerable:
Check Android security patch level in Settings > About phone > Android version. If patch level is before June 2024, device is vulnerable.
Check Version:
adb shell getprop ro.build.version.security_patch
Verify Fix Applied:
Verify the security patch level shows 'June 5, 2024' or later in Settings > About phone > Android version.
